machinepools

package
v1.2.36-rc1 Latest Latest
Warning

This package is not in the latest version of its module.

Go to latest
Published: Feb 26, 2024 License: Apache-2.0 Imports: 10 Imported by: 0

Documentation

Index

Constants

This section is empty.

Variables

This section is empty.

Functions

func GetLabelMap added in v1.2.17

func GetLabelMap(cmd *cobra.Command, r *rosa.Runtime, existingLabels map[string]string,
	inputLabels string) map[string]string

func GetTaints added in v1.2.17

func GetTaints(cmd *cobra.Command, r *rosa.Runtime, existingTaints []*cmv1.Taint,
	inputTaints string) []*cmv1.TaintBuilder

func HostedClusterOnlyFlag added in v1.2.18

func HostedClusterOnlyFlag(r *rosa.Runtime, cmd *cobra.Command, flagName string)

func LabelValidator added in v1.2.17

func LabelValidator(val interface{}) error

func MaxNodePoolReplicaValidator

func MaxNodePoolReplicaValidator(minReplicas int) interactive.Validator

func MinNodePoolReplicaValidator

func MinNodePoolReplicaValidator(autoscaling bool) interactive.Validator

func ParseLabels added in v1.2.17

func ParseLabels(labels string) (map[string]string, error)

func ParseTaints added in v1.2.17

func ParseTaints(taints string) ([]*cmv1.TaintBuilder, error)

func ValidateLabelKeyValuePair added in v1.2.17

func ValidateLabelKeyValuePair(key, value string) error

Types

This section is empty.

Jump to

Keyboard shortcuts

? : This menu
/ : Search site
f or F : Jump to
y or Y : Canonical URL